Vivo X60 Pro is slightly better than the Honor 50, getting a overall score of 78.8 against 74.5. These phones work with the same Android 11 OS, so both of them should provide all the same OS features. Vivo X60 Pro is a just a little heavier phone than Honor 50, but both of them have the same thickness.
Vivo X60 Pro has just a bit better display than Honor 50, and although they both have a display with the same size, the vivo X60 Pro also has a slightly higher resolution of 1080 x 2376px and a bit more pixels per inch in the screen. Vivo X60 Pro counts with a bit better CPU than Honor 50, and although they both have 8 processing cores, the vivo X60 Pro also has more RAM memory.
Vivo X60 Pro has a way bigger storage to store more apps and games than Honor 50, because it has 256 GB internal storage capacity. The Honor 50 counts with a bit better camera than vivo X60 Pro, because although it has lower video frame rate and a tinier aperture which is not good for low-light images and videos, and they both have the same 3840x2160 video definition, the Honor 50 also counts with a much more mega pixels back facing camera.
The Honor 50 has just a bit longer battery lifetime than vivo X60 Pro, because it has 4300mAh of battery capacity against 4200mAh.
